Common questions about acura repair services in Quincy, MO
Given the rural roads and variable Midwest weather, common issues include premature wear on suspension components like struts and control arm bushings, as well as problems with the Variable Valve Timing (VVT) system. Brake system wear is also accelerated due to the mix of highway driving and stop-and-go traffic on local routes.
Look for a shop with certified technicians, specifically those with ASE certification or direct Acura training, as general mechanics may lack specific expertise. In the Quincy area, it's also valuable to seek shops that source genuine or OEM-quality parts and have strong local reputation, which you can verify through community recommendations or online reviews.
You should seek a specialist for complex system diagnostics, transmission issues, or repairs involving the SH-AWD system, which is unique to Acura. For general maintenance like oil changes, a reputable local mechanic may suffice, but for Quincy's hilly terrain, ensuring the AWD system is properly serviced is best left to experts.
Labor rates in Quincy may be slightly lower than in major metropolitan areas, but the overall cost for a proper repair is often comparable due to the need to order specialized Acura parts. The key is to find a local shop with fair pricing that uses quality parts to avoid repeat repairs, saving money long-term.
The seasonal extremes—hot summers and cold, sometimes snowy winters—mean you should pay close attention to your cooling system, battery health, and tire condition. Additionally, the prevalence of gravel and less-maintained rural roads necessitates more frequent inspections of your Acura's undercarriage, alignment, and tire tread.
